Keep a record of all critical information when you travel out of the country. Include your embassy’s web address, physical address and phone number. You will need to contact the embassy if you have any trouble. They have a lot of experience with issues travelers face, and they will help.

Choosing a seat on the aisle will open more options for you. While you can see well out of the window seat, that is about all it does for you. Sitting on the aisle allows you to reach your luggage and easily get up to go to the bathroom.

Always check expiration dates on of all of your passports. Some countries have very specific rules regarding passports, including when they expire. You may not be allowed into their country if your passport is expiring in a certain amount of time. This can be from 3-6 months of your trip, though there are some places where that time frame can be 8-12 months.
